#Coded by Andrew C
import pandas as pd
import numpy as np
from sklearn import datasets
from sklearn.linear_model import LinearRegression
from sklearn.model_selection import train_test_split
wine_dataset = datasets.load_wine()
wine = pd.DataFrame(wine_dataset.data, columns=wine_dataset.feature_names)
X = wine[['ash']]
Y = wine['alcohol']
#Fit Data
X_train, X_test, Y_train, Y_test = train_test_split(X, Y, test_size = 0.3, random_state=1)
model = LinearRegression()
model.fit(X_train, Y_train)
#Print Results
print("Intercept: " + str(model.intercept_.round(2)))
print("Slope: " + (str(model.coef_.round(2))))
print("Formula: Y = " + str(model.intercept_.round(2)) + " + " + str(model.coef_.round(2)) + " * X")
Watch video Python Bytes - Sklearn Linear Regression online without registration, duration hours minute second in high quality. This video was added by user AC 08 April 2023, don't forget to share it with your friends and acquaintances, it has been viewed on our site 1,024 once and liked it 12 people.